The Waitakere Ranges: What else can be more interesting than the 16,000 hectares of native rainforest along with extended coastline and natural treasures like waterfalls and wildlife for a delightful indulgence. The stunning region gives you a feeling of a different world from the modern city of Auckland. Take 40 minutes drive from the city centre to reach this amazing nature escape. The highlights of the area include hundred kilometres of walking trails, Karekare Falls and Beach and spectacular scenery throughout.
Goat Island Marine Reserve: The stunning and beautiful underwater world of New Zealand’s first marine reserve is an unforgettable experience. It was established in 1975 and is home to rich ecological diversity, teeming with fish and other sea life. The best way to explore the stunning sea habitat is through snorkelling or by scuba diving in colourful sands, deep reefs, underwater cliffs and canyons. Visit shallow areas of the reserve, particularly off the main beach to explore many varieties of fish and shellfish.
Tawharanui Regional Park: The picturesque and engaging route of State Highway 1 leads to stunning Tawharanui Regional Park. It is one of the best places to surf, play and swim in the whole Auckland region. The road to Tawharanui passes through the famous rural area of Matakana, which is known for craft studios, cafes and vineyards. There are several longer walking trails and great picnic spots that make the area ideal for family outing.
Rangitoto Island: The iconic Rangitoto Island is famous for volcanic cones and features world’s largest pohutukawa forest. The destination is the first choice for hikers and day-explorers. It is the youngest and largest volcano in the Auckland volcanic field and came to light around 600 years back.
